LAST-OF-ALL ART UNION.

PRINCIPAL PRIZE WINNERS. AUCKLAND. May 9. The drawing of the Last-of-all Art Union was carried out on Saturday evening at the Chamber of Commerce by members of a large audience, and was supervised by a representative of the police. The follow-ing-are the prize winners:— First (£350), Mrs A. Shepherd. Epsom, Auckland.

Second (£75), James Scott, care of Fleni ing and Co., Gore.

Third (£25), Mrs Bigwood, Chaney’s, Christchurch.

Ten of £5 each. —Mr Kibblewhite. Lower Hutt; M. Cokar, Hataitai; Mrs Wellington, Waitui, Inglewood; Mm W. J. Gallagher, Prebbleton; Thomas Jackson, Takapuna ; Miss Stark, 48 Durham street, Christchurch; Mrs Deeble, 37 Arthur street Wellington; Mrs Longstaff, 198 Adelaide road, Wellington; A. East, Pahiatua; J. Valvoi, Auckland. —
